

IT Care Center and Atomicwork compete in the IT management solutions category. IT Care Center excels in pricing and support, while Atomicwork is favored for its rich features despite a higher cost.
Features: IT Care Center offers an intuitive ticketing system, integrated asset management, and efficient core functionalities. Atomicwork provides advanced automation capabilities, seamless integration with third-party applications, and innovative solutions for complex IT setups.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: IT Care Center features a straightforward deployment model and strong support for quick response to queries. Atomicwork offers a cloud-based deployment option with effective support for large organizations with complex needs, providing flexibility aligned with diverse structures.
Pricing and ROI: IT Care Center is recognized for competitive pricing and lower setup costs, ensuring a quicker ROI. Atomicwork, though more expensive, justifies the cost with comprehensive features that contribute to long-term value, making it a good investment for larger enterprises seeking extensive capabilities.

IT Care Center enhances IT management through efficient ticket handling, workflow creation, and extensive integrations, enabling customized solutions and promoting self-sufficiency.
Known for its robust features, IT Care Center is ideal for managing IT incidents, requests, and change management. It streamlines workflows for HR processes like onboarding and offboarding, supports project management, and offers dashboards, license management, and monitoring capabilities. With plans for cloud migration, it aims to further enhance deployment flexibility while needing improvements in mobile responsiveness, UI design, SSO integration, and admin resources. Users seek enhanced connectivity with tools such as Teams and Cisco, and the development of a native mobile application for better productivity tracking.
